CLEARLAKE >> The Lake County Theatre Company (LCTC) will be partnering with the Clearlake Youth Center (CYC) to put on “The Mafia Murders,” a 1930s gangster-themed murder mystery dinner on Wednesday at the Clearlake Youth Center, located at 4750 Golf Ave.

Drinks will begin at 6 p.m., followed by a Cornish game hen dinner at 7 p.m. The mystery will unfold as you dine and features a very talented cast of characters, including Barbara Clark, John Tomlinson, Tim Fischer, Toni Stewart, Suna Flores, Larry and Zoe Richardson, Fallon Deiner, Joyce Overton, Kim Vanhorn, Lake County Superindant of Schools Brock Falkenberg and Sheriff-elect Brian Martin and his wife Crystal.

Once the audience finds out “who dunnit”, the evening will wrap up at around 9 p.m., enabling party-goers to ring in the New Year at midnight elsewhere.

LCTC and CYC partnered for a Mother”s Day-themed murder mystery earlier this year, which was extremely popular and was nearly sold out. Tickets cost $40 per person. There will also be a raffle, with the big-ticket item being a seven night stay anywhere in the world. All proceeds will benefit LCTC and CYC.
